What are Fascias?

Fascias are horizontal boards that are installed at the edge of the roofline. Normally made from materials such as wood, PVC, or aluminum, fascias assist to support the lower edge of the roof and function as a barrier versus the elements. They are typically the first line of defense versus wind, rain, and insects.

Fascia Services Overview

Fascia services encompass a range of tasks including setup, repair, upkeep, and replacement. Below is a comprehensive table outlining the primary fascia services readily available:

Fascia ServiceDescriptionBenefits
SetupNew fascia boards are installed during brand-new construction or remodelling tasks.Ensures a secure and visually enticing roofline.
RepairDamaged fascias are fixed to restore performance and visual appeals.Extends the lifespan of existing fascias and conserves costs.
ReplacementOld or significantly damaged fascias are eliminated and changed with new materials.Boosts protection and improves home insulation.
Painting or FinishingApplication of weather-resistant paint or surfaces to protect and enhance fascias.Boosts toughness and adds visual interest.
Assessment & & MaintenanceRoutine inspections to assess the condition of fascias.Early recognition of issues to avoid pricey repairs later on.

Value of Fascia Services

  1. Preventative Measures: Regular upkeep of fascias can prevent more extreme damage to the roof and walls, which can conserve homeowners considerable money in the long run.

  2. Visual Improvement: Well-maintained fascias can enhance the curb appeal of a property, potentially increasing its market worth.

  3. Energy Efficiency: Properly set up fascias assist in insulation, which can add to energy efficiency by controlling the internal temperature of the home.

  4. Bug Control: Fascias function as a barrier against insects and birds, avoiding them from nesting in the eaves.

4. Can I paint my fascias?

Yes, painting your fascias can improve their look and add an extra layer of security versus the components. It's important to use weather-resistant paint for best results.

5. What is the typical expense of fascia setup?

The expense of fascia setup differs widely depending on the material used and the scope of the job. Usually, house owners can expect to pay between ₤ 5 to ₤ 15 per linear foot for fascia installation.
